I just submitted a new entry for the CD vendors list and would like to raise a few issues. First of all, it refused the accented character in my name (invalid data in submission form). Then I have made the choice to sell unofficial DVD that includes firmwares. How are we supposed to deal with that? I'm pretty sure some people will want to not list those vendors and it would make the FSF uncomfortable, but on the other hand there will be users seeking for those discs. I would thus suggest to add a new column to differentiate vendors that sell: - only official images - only unofficial images - both BTW I submitted my entry for the United States because that's where the discs are produced and shipped from. But I'm French... I hope it's ok. I would suggest to have a section "International" where all vendors that ship world-wide are listed together with a Location column. That way a user looks up his own country first, and then goes to the international section if there was none suitable in his country. We could thus spare the "Ship International" column and add the new one suggested above instead.
